Digger Phelps to Serve As Keynote Speaker at Men's Basketball Banquet
April 4, 2006 MILWAUKEE - The Marquette men's basketball team will hold its annual awards banquet on Monday, April 24 at the Monaghan Ballroom in the Alumni Memorial Union. ESPN college basketball analyst and former Notre Dame head coach Digger Phelps will serve as keynote speaker for the program. The banquet will also feature award presentations, a recap of Marquette's first season in the BIG EAST and its trip to the NCAA Tournament, and a tribute to the three seniors -- Joe Chapman, Chris Grimm and Steve Novak. The banquet starts at 6:30 p.m. with a reception beginning at 5:30 p.m. The cost to attend the banquet is $50.
